
Meta Platforms Inc. is establishing a new artificial intelligence lab focused on developing superintelligence, marking a strategic shift beyond artificial general intelligence (AGI). This initiative comes amid delays in the rollout of Meta's Llama 4 Behemoth AI model. The company plans to invest approximately $15 billion in this effort to advance its AI capabilities. Meta's recruitment efforts for the lab are underway as it intensifies competition in the AI industry. This development highlights Meta's commitment to pushing the boundaries of AI technology, even as other players in the field focus on different aspects of artificial intelligence.
